Running along the lateral thigh, the descending branch of the lateral circumflex femoral artery is shown emerging from the profunda femoris system near the proximal femur and tracking inferiorly toward the lateral aspect of the knee. Its course lies anterior to the lateral intermuscular septum and deep to the iliotibial tract, traveling between the vastus lateralis and adjacent musculature before approaching the peripatellar arterial network. Distally, the vessel contributes to the genicular anastomosis around the patella, with companion veins rendered in blue alongside the dominant red arterial pathway. From a lateral perspective, this artery matters because it is a predictable feeder for the anterolateral thigh and a frequent pedicle in reconstructive planning. Surgeons raising an anterolateral thigh (ALT) flap commonly rely on perforators from the descending branch, and preoperative mapping often tracks this long segment as it runs toward the knee. Around the distal femur and patella, its contribution to the genicular anastomosis becomes clinically relevant in collateral flow when the superficial femoral artery is stenosed or occluded.
